Zenith Bank Plc is a major financial services provider in Nigeria and Anglophone West Africa, headquartered in Victoria Island, Lagos. It is licensed as a commercial bank by the Central Bank of Nigeria, the national banking regulator.

    Nigerian. Occupation. Businessman. Jim James Ovia CFR CON (born 4 November 1951) is a Nigerian businessman and author. He is the founder of Zenith Bank, which he founded in 1990, [1] and is now the country's most profitable bank. [2][3][4] In 2018, Ovia published what he described as an "entrepreneurial manual" he called Africa Rise and Shine. [4]

    After schooling, he entered business and banking, eventually rising to hold several high-ranking executive positions at banks. By the mid-2000s, Shettima was the manager of Zenith Bank's Maiduguri branch before leaving the position to enter the state cabinet of Governor Ali Modu Sheriff in 2007.
